Are people in Watertown older or younger than people in Danielson?
- The Median Age in Watertown is 3.9 years older than in Danielson.

Are housing costs cheaper in Watertown or Danielson?
- Watertown housing costs are 5.6% more expensive than Danielson hous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Watertown or Danielson?
- The average commute for residents of Watertown is 3.6 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Danielson.

Things to do in Danielson?
Danielson, Connecticut is a small rural town in the northeast part of the state. It is home to about 4,000 people, and it has a peaceful, relaxed atmosphere. There are plenty of natural areas to explore, such as forests and rivers, and the town also has several parks for visitors and locals alike. The town offers plenty of attractions including the Johnson-Lloyd Art Museum and the Danielson Music Hall. Additionally, there are several local shops and businesses offering unique items and services for residents. Overall, living in Danielson is a great experience that provides its citizens with a sense of community and relaxation away from larger cities.
